Transaction 76c39d73f274d1e9c27ece97766e8afed2e89e791520f01fa4217caef8ca9e79

3 Input
2 Outputs
  • 76c39d73f274d1e9c27ece97766e8afed2e89e791520f01fa4217caef8ca9e79:0
  • value  150000000
    address  13eZKF9g9TyKMrda4AzJXQ7XnsLhmv3ToA
  • 76c39d73f274d1e9c27ece97766e8afed2e89e791520f01fa4217caef8ca9e79:1
  • value  43080350
    address  13kSmyZetrPoCBEwfVtwbKZxS6E7JhCPEr